The Operational Risk Manager leads the strategic initiative to provide operational risk/return expertise to the organization. This role has deep insights across business/functional areas to challenge and report. This role is responsible for implementing and influencing the ORRM framework across Allstate. The Operational Risk framework consists of tools, standards, and risk processes through which ORRM directs and assists MFBs/AORs to identify and assess risk, mitigate risk in accordance with appetite and analyze and understand the risk environment overall.

**Key Responsibilities**:
- Influences the appropriate management of risk, including: monitoring, reporting, and an escalation structure to optimize risk and return.
- Performs operational risk assessments with business units.
- Professional knowledge in operational risk management and its impact on the enterprise.
- Leads the implementation of the ORRM framework to optimize enterprise risk and return management strategy.
- Accountable to escalate and report significant issues.
- Responsible for effective independent challenge of first line risk management activities, thematic reviews and ‘deep dives’.
- Integrates information and data to form hypotheses and assumptions of future impact.
- Reviews, researches, interprets, and analyzes operational risk data to identify trends, emerging risks, and issues.
- Communicates to leadership, this includes presenting information to the Operational Risk Council and Enterprise Risk and Return Council.
- Contributes and leads the strategy of the enterprise’s risk management program.
